MSFT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2014 in Review

1,988 of the 3,464 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Microsoft (MSFT) for Q1 2014, worth a combined $237B — up 10% from $215B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 124 funds opened new MSFT positions and 74 closed out — a net gain of 50 holders — while 811 added to existing stakes and 894 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Capital World Investors, adding an estimated $1.1B. The largest seller was State Street, cutting an estimated $1.21B.
